Zircon U-Pb Geochronology and Petrogenesis of Taipinggou Copper (Gold)-related Granites, South Qinling

  • 太平沟铜(金)矿床位处秦岭造山带南秦岭印支期褶皱带与老牛山-胭脂坝燕山期北东向构造岩浆岩带交汇的构造结合部位,与矿化相关的蚀变岩体呈似椭圆状,地表出露面积为0.12 km2;蚀变岩体以石英闪长岩、细粒花岗岩为主,局部可见有斑状花岗岩,其中石英闪长岩、细粒花岗岩与铜(金)矿化具有密切的成生关系。锆石的LA-ICP-MS U-Pb年代学研究表明,太平沟矿化石英闪长岩成岩年龄为(223.2±2.9)Ma,表明其侵位于晚三叠世,指示本地区铜(金)矿化成矿时代为印支晚期。岩石地球化学分析表明,石英闪长岩具有富钾(Na2O/K2O=1.21~1.75)和富碱(Na2O+K2O=7.31%~9.67%)的特点,属高钾钙碱性系列准铝质岩石;岩石的稀土元素总量较高,具明显负Eu异常,稀土配分模式呈明显右倾型;微量元素以Ba、U、K等大离子亲石元素富集,Nb、P、Ti等高场强元素亏损为特点,属于I型花岗岩。综合分析认为,太平沟铜(金)矿床为印支晚期岩浆活动的产物,暗示南秦岭宁陕—镇安地区存在重要的印支晚期岩浆成矿事件。
